Public records show Ellicott City, Philadelphia, Abingdon and 2 other cities as cities Richard also stayed in. 26939 Honeymoon Ave, Leesburg, Fl 34748 is where Richard resides. Richard owns the phone number (352) 787-4181. 1949 is his birth date. The current age of Richard is 75. People possibly related to Richard are Claudia A Kubis, Jennifer Leigh Shoemaker, Stacy Ann Kubis and one other person.
One is the number of properties that Richard has. According to the public records his property address is 26939 HONEYMOON AVE, LEESBURG FL, FL 34748. The value of his property is $144,191.